How do you tackle making your business greener? Indeed, what does it mean for a business to go green? In essence, this is a subject that focuses on environmental sustainability. Companies all over the world are utilizing Environmental Social Governance as a structure to work towards environmentally friendly business goals. What is Environmental Social Governance? In essence, it is a concept that concentrates on internal and external business practice. Therefore, it also covers sustainable business principles; certainly, this aspect of Environmental Social Governance has actually been highly prominent in how companies go about incorporating eco-friendly business practices into their method operandi. For example, in the property industry, companies have actually taken a look at how to make buildings 'greener' (not in the visual sense, but ecologically speaking). How have they gone about executing this technique? Well, by referring to Environmental Social Governance as a structure, they have made use of technology to minimize energy waste, with digital sensors being utilized to efficiently monitor and minimize ecological waste from a structure. Supply chains and manufacturing practices have actually also been areas that property companies have tried to deal with, whether it be through utilizing recycled materials or by expediating the shipment process through tech, conserving time and decreasing ecological waste in the process. Another popular example of sustainable business in action can be seen in the agricultural sector, with companies likewise using digital sensing units to monitor crop health; this can assist in saving ecological waste and make general practice more environmentally sustainable.

What are some of the benefits of making your business more sustainable? Well, aside from the important environmental significance, research study has revealed that companies that implement Ecological Social Governance are more favoured by potential workers; hence, green business practices can have a positive effect on recruitment. Green businesses can likewise accomplish an excellent connection with their clients through a values of sustainability. Green business concepts can be both on a small or big scale; from filling up empty ink cartridges to investing in regional tasks that benefit the community and the environment. Making your business more environmentally friendly is a task that companies all around the world are attempting to carry out. However, instead of see it merely as an obligation, some businesses have likewise recognised that by working within this conceptual framework, chances for development are possible. This can clearly be seen in the form of recycling. Business recycling has become an important part of Environmental Social Governance, inspiring numerous specific niche services and sectors while doing so. What are some of the advantages of integrating recycling designs into your business? Well, aside from the ecological benefits, recycling can likewise conserve your company costs on basic materials.
